Bee sting treatment

ph9vde2v401.jpg
Splash, Corbis

Ouch! In an interview with The New York Times, the Hollywood actress confessed that she does apitherapy, which is the practice of purposely getting bees to sting you to get rid of inflammation and scarring. Who knew bee venom was so great for your skin?!

Bubble nails

phebx609c81-1.png
DancesWith Wolvesss/Instagram

Bubble nails is all about getting a 3D effect, which is achieved by piling acrylic on the nail without filing it down. The result is an exaggerated curve with plenty of pop!
